Unitech International Limited, founded in 1994, focuses on the recycling of ferrous and non-ferrous metals, specializing in copper, brass, and aluminum. It holds a 100% Export Oriented Unit status granted by the Government of India. The company also operates in the manufacture and sale of metal drums, barrels, and agriculture equipment, indicating diversification in its business activities. Unitech's involvement in e-waste recycling underscores the company's commitment to environmentally friendly practices. Their competitors include major industry players like Mitsubishi and DuPont, highlighting the competitive landscape in which Unitech operates.
